Hard Drive Reliability Comparison

When it comes to selecting a hard drive, reliability is paramount. Different brands and types of hard drives exhibit varying levels of durability, which is crucial for both personal and professional use. HDDs traditionally offer larger storage capacities at lower price points but have lower reliability compared to SSDs. Factors contributing to reliability include build quality, internal components, and usage conditions. For instance, SSDs have no moving parts, making them inherently more reliable under physical stress, whereas HDDs can suffer from mechanical failures.

An interesting aspect of hard drive reliability is the failure rate, which can be monitored through various consumer reports and studies. For example, according to a well-known reliability study, certain brands have shown significantly lower failure rates over time. Knowing the statistics behind hard drive failure can help consumers make an informed choice, as some brands tend to dominate the market due to their commitment to quality and robust customer service.

Moreover, environmental conditions play a notable role in hard drive longevity. Drives located in cooler, less humid environments tend to last longer than those subjected to heat and moisture. It’s essential to consider your usage context when choosing a hard drive. Therefore, implementing proper cooling solutions and ensuring stable power supply can enhance the reliability of your chosen storage solution.

Lastly, regular maintenance and health monitoring can extend the life of your hard drive. Utilizing tools for monitoring drive health, like S.M.A.R.T. status checks, can alert you to potential issues before they lead to catastrophic failures. This proactive approach not only enhances reliability but also ensures that data integrity is maintained over time.

Top Rated Storage Devices for Gaming

Gamers require fast and responsive storage devices to ensure smooth gameplay, making the selection of the right hard drive or SSD crucial. Among the top rated storage devices for gaming are NVMe SSDs, which provide lightning-fast read and write speeds, significantly reducing load times. Gamers who wish to maximize their performance often opt for high-capacity NVMe drives that can handle heavy-duty gaming applications without lagging.

A favorite among gamers is the Samsung 970 EVO Plus, praised for its impressive performance benchmarks and reliability. With high sequential read speeds, this SSD not only enhances gameplay but also offers adequate space for multiple large-scale games. Other brands like Western Digital and Crucial have also made their mark with user-friendly SSDs that cater exclusively to gamers, offering durability and speed at competitive prices.

Additionally, external SSDs are becoming increasingly popular among gamers for their portability and speed. Devices like the SanDisk Extreme Portable SSD enable gamers to carry their libraries while ensuring rapid access speeds. This aspect is particularly appealing for console gamers who need to expand their storage without sacrificing performance.

Ultimately, it’s essential to consider not only speed but also the lifespan of the storage device chosen for gaming. Reading through reviews of hard drive brands helps in identifying which products consistently offer quality and performance, thus aiding gamers in making informed choices that enhance their overall gaming experience.

Best Hard Drive Brands

When discussing the best hard drive brands, several names stand out due to their commitment to quality, performance, and customer satisfaction. Western Digital and Seagate have long been industry leaders, offering a range of HDDs and SSDs that cater to different user needs. Western Digital’s Blue series is particularly popular among budget-conscious consumers seeking reliable performance without breaking the bank.

Another brand worth mentioning is Toshiba, which has made impressive strides in the storage market by offering reliable and high-performance drives. Their X300 series, designed for gaming and creative professionals, boasts excellent read/write speeds and resilience against shock, making them ideal for demanding applications.

For those seeking premium options, brands like Samsung and SanDisk have carved out a niche in the SSD market. Samsung’s 860 EVO is celebrated for its outstanding performance and durability, making it a top choice for both gamers and content creators alike. SanDisk, on the other hand, is known for its portable SSD solutions that combine speed and portability, catering to users on the go.

Finally, it’s essential to look out for the warranty and customer service offered by these brands. A reliable brand not only offers stellar products but also stands behind them, providing peace of mind to consumers who invest in their hard drives. Reading user reviews and expert assessments can give insight into which brands are currently leading the pack in terms of both innovation and reliability.
